In a groundbreaking declaration that had a resounding impact worldwide, the World Health Organization (WHO) officially announced the conclusion of the COVID-19 pandemic as a global public health emergency in May of the previous year. This momentous declaration represented a significant triumph for the international health and scientific community, signifying the end of a period characterized by challenges, resilience, and scientific achievements.

Triumph of Science and International Collaboration

The rescinding of the pandemic’s emergency status is no small accomplishment. It is the result of an unprecedented global endeavor to combat the most severe public health crisis in a century. Collaboratively, countries worldwide came together, working on the development, production, and distribution of vaccines across all regions. This partnership ensured that no country was left behind, highlighting the power of unity and collaboration in the face of adversity.
